Rohan Lavery

[4] Lavery made his Australian representative debut as stroke of the coxless four at the 2019 U23 World Rowing Championships in Sarasota, Florida.

[5] In March 2022 Lavery was selected in the Australian team for the 2022 international season and the 2022 World Rowing Championships.

[6] He stroked the Australian men's eight to silver medal placings at each of the World Rowing Cups in June and July.

[5] The eight won through their repechage to make the A final where they raced to a third place and a World Championship bronze medal.

[5] In March 2023 Lavery was again selected in the Australian senior men's sweep-oar squad for the 2023 international season.
